Many commercial ginger ale drinks use artificial ginger flavoring. Some also contain very little ginger and a lot of added sugar. Ginger may have an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. It may also help with headaches and nausea and provide benefits for heart health.
Ginger ale is a popular type of soda made with ginger. Many people drink ginger ale to relieve nausea, but you can also enjoy it as an everyday beverage.
Ginger root is the underground stem of the ginger plant. It has a long history of medicinal and health uses, especially related to the digestive system
Consuming ginger may help relieve upset stomach and nausea related to stomach flu, severe migraines, chemotherapy, or morning sickness in pregnancy.
Ginger oil is a natural source of antioxidants, compounds that protect cells from damage that can lead to disease. However, its antioxidant content decreases with processing
Ginger contains compounds that may have anti-inflammatory effects on the brain and joints
Ginger may help lower high blood pressure, which is a risk factor for heart disease and stroke
Ginger ale is naturally caffeine-free, which may make it a good alternative to cola or other caffeinated beverages
